Show Notes

In this episode of  Nonprofit Spotlight, Stephanie Engs talks with Kathy Ogden, the founder, and ambassador of Courtney’s Courage. Courtney’s Courage is dedicated to raising funds for children’s cancer research, specifically neuroblastoma, and to assist with support services for pediatric cancer patients being treated at Banner Children’s -Diamond Children’s Medical Center and their families. They discuss the history and growth of Courtney’s Courage over the years and how their programs are guided by families who their organization serves.
